TIE privileged accounts issues

Back
Id5c170c73-75ba-48ea-8dfc-e4e2d4f23979
RulenameTIE privileged accounts issues
DescriptionSearches for triggered Indicators of Exposures related to privileged accounts issues.
SeverityLow
TacticsCredentialAccess
TechniquesT1110
Required data connectorsTenableIE
KindScheduled
Query frequency2h
Query period2h
Trigger threshold0
Trigger operatorgt
Source Urihttps://github.com/Azure/Azure-Sentinel/blob/master/Solutions/Tenable App/Analytic Rules/TIEPrivilegedAccountIssues.yaml
Version1.0.1
Arm template5c170c73-75ba-48ea-8dfc-e4e2d4f23979.json
Deploy To Azure
// For the query to work properly, make sure you have imported the afad_parser.yaml parser into the workspace
// Retrieve the parser here: https://aka.ms/sentinel-TenableApp-afad-parser
// Then, create the Kusto Function with alias afad_parser
let SeverityTable=datatable(Severity:string,Level:int) [
"low", 1,
"medium", 2,
"high", 3,
"critical", 4
];
let codeNameList = datatable(Codename:string)["C-PRIV-ACCOUNTS-SPN", "C-NATIVE-ADM-GROUP-MEMBERS", "C-KRBTGT-PASSWORD", "C-PROTECTED-USERS-GROUP-UNUSED", "C-ADMINCOUNT-ACCOUNT-PROPS", "C-ADM-ACC-USAGE", "C-LAPS-UNSECURE-CONFIG", "C-DISABLED-ACCOUNTS-PRIV-GROUPS"];
afad_parser
| where MessageType == 0 and Codename in~ (codeNameList)
| lookup kind=leftouter SeverityTable on Severity
| order by Level
| extend HostName = tostring(split(Host, '.', 0)[0]), DnsDomain = tostring(strcat_array(array_slice(split(Host, '.'), 1, -1), '.'))
